Main Ingredients and Substitutions

Grape Juice is the base of this cocktail, offering a smooth and neutral flavor that blends beautifully with rich creamers and coffee liqueurs. You can also use spiced grape juice for a warming kick that complements the fall flavors.

Pumpkin Spice Creamer is what sets this drink apart. A store-bought version works perfectly, but homemade creamer gives you the flexibility to adjust sweetness and spice levels. For those who prefer non-dairy options, almond, oat, or coconut creamers are excellent alternatives.

Coffee Liqueur such as Kahlúa adds depth and a subtle coffee bitterness to balance the sweetness. If you want to skip the alcohol, a splash of cold brew coffee mixed with simple syrup can provide a similar flavor.

Graham Cracker Rim elevates this drink into a true dessert cocktail. The crunchy, slightly sweet rim pairs beautifully with the creamy interior. If graham crackers aren’t available, crushed speculoos cookies or cinnamon sugar make a great substitute.

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Start by preparing the graham cracker rim. Crush the crackers into fine crumbs and spread them on a plate. Lightly moisten the rim of your serving glass with water or cream, then dip it into the crumbs until coated.
  2. In a cocktail shaker filled with ice, combine grape juice, pumpkin spice creamer, and coffee liqueur. Shake gently until chilled.
  3. Strain the mixture into the prepared glass over ice.
  4. Top with whipped cream and a sprinkle of pumpkin pie spice for garnish.
  5. For a lighter version, substitute low-fat creamer or almond milk to create a skinny variation of the drink.

FAQs About Pumpkin Spice White Russian cocktail

Can I make a dairy-free version of this cocktail?

Yes. Simply swap the pumpkin spice creamer for a plant-based version made from almond, oat, or coconut milk. The flavor remains creamy and festive.

How do I make a non-alcoholic pumpkin spice White Russian?

Replace the coffee liqueur with cold brew coffee and skip the grape juice. You’ll still get the delicious pumpkin spice flavor with a smooth coffee kick.

Can I prepare this cocktail ahead of time?

Yes, you can mix the grape juice, coffee liqueur, and pumpkin spice creamer in advance and store it in the fridge. Just give it a good stir before serving and add ice and garnish at the last moment.

What’s the best garnish for presentation?

Whipped cream and a dusting of pumpkin pie spice are classics, but you can also try caramel drizzle, chocolate shavings, or even a sprinkle of crushed cookies for extra flair.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 oz grape juice (or spiced grape juice)
  • 1 oz coffee liqueur (such as Kahlúa)
  • 2 oz pumpkin spice creamer (dairy or non-dairy)
  • Ice cubes
  • 1 graham cracker, crushed (for rim)
  • Whipped cream (optional garnish)
  • Pinch of pumpkin pie spice (optional garnish)

Instructions

  1. Crush graham crackers into fine crumbs and place on a plate.
  2. Moisten the rim of a rocks glass with water or cream, then dip it into the crumbs to coat.
  3. Fill a cocktail shaker with ice and add grape juice, pumpkin spice creamer, and coffee liqueur.
  4. Shake gently until chilled.
  5. Strain the mixture into the prepared glass filled with ice.
  6. Top with whipped cream and a sprinkle of pumpkin pie spice, if desired.
  7. Serve immediately and enjoy.

Notes

For a non-alcoholic version, replace the coffee liqueur with cold brew coffee. Use plant-based creamers like almond, oat, or coconut milk for a dairy-free option. Garnish ideas include caramel drizzle, chocolate shavings, or crushed cookies for extra flair.
